Evaluating AI Supplier Evaluation Process & Recommended Practices

Selecting the ideal intelligent supplier is essential for realizing business success. A robust review structure is necessary to mitigate potential problems and guarantee value. This must include the detailed assessment of the provider's capabilities across various dimensions, such as technical framework, information safeguarding, growth, and continued assistance. Best approaches advise building a ranked evaluation method based on your organization's specific demands. In addition, thoroughly examining client feedback and carrying out proof-of-concept programs are invaluable steps.

Tackling AI Procurement: Risk & Regulation

Successfully deploying artificial intelligence requires a robust framework for selection that diligently considers both threat and oversight. Organizations must move beyond simply evaluating performance and instead establish clear workflows for assessing the likely ethical, legal, and operational dilemmas. This includes, but isn’t limited to, understanding data security, ensuring explainability in AI decision-making, and implementing mechanisms for ongoing assessment. A layered strategy, encompassing vendor scrutiny, defined usage guidelines, and proactive reduction plans, is essential to diminish potential liabilities and foster trustworthy AI adoption. Failure to adequately address these crucial aspects can lead to considerable reputational damage, regulatory fines, and ultimately, undermine the advantages of AI investments.
